Performance breakdown
Germination reliability
Untreated seeds consistently sprout with minimal effort for novice gardeners.
Bloom uniformity
Professional-grade genetics ensure a predictable, consistent height and structure.
Pollinator appeal
Vibrant, open-faced blooms act as a magnet for local bees.
Color variety
An expansive palette offers endless combinations for cutting garden arrangements.
Yield potential
High-output plants keep producing fresh stems throughout the growing season.
Ease of cultivation
Thrives in full sun with very little maintenance required post-planting.
